A new episode of the "bank fraud" case was sent to court; the ex-president of BEM and his special administrator will be in the dock.

The Prosecutor General's Office reported this, noting that a new charge was brought against the former acting chairman of Banca de Economii Viorel Birca, whose case was brought to court a week ago on charges of “embezzlement of other people's property on an especially large scale”. This time, the Anti-Corruption Prosecutor's Office announced the completion and transfer to the court of a criminal case on a different episode, separated from the case of the "bank fraud", in which the former interim chairman of Banca de Economii is accused together with the head of the National Bank's department - former BEM special administrator Ion Ropot. In particular, prosecutors collected evidence that in November 2014 these two, acting together with other members of a criminal group, allegedly stole $10 million and 8 million euros from interbank placements provided by Moldindconbank and Moldova Agroindbank for Banca de Economii. According to the materials, the guarantee for the return of these interbank placements was 35% of Victoriabank's shares, which were pledged by INSIDOWN LTD (Cyprus), an affiliate of Vladimir Plahotniuc and Ilan Shor, in favor of Moldindconbank and Moldova Agroindbank, as well as pledge agreements. On November 28, 2014, at the expense of a state-guaranteed urgent loan, that is, from the state budget, the debt of Banca de Economii to Moldova Agroindbank and Moldindconbank in the amount of 8 million euros and $10 million was repaid. The operation took place without returning the money from the funds of the pledged property, which guaranteed the return of these placements, and the pledge - 35% of Victoriabank's shares - was released (canceled) in the interests of the criminal group. After being heard by the Prosecutor's Office on the charges, the two men did not plead guilty. To compensate for the damage caused following the crime, the Prosecutor's Office seized 5 real estate objects of the accused with the possibility of their special confiscation in favor of the state. Former Acting BEM Chairman Viorel Birca was detained in early December 2020 along with 5 other persons, including the former heads of 3 bankrupt banks (Banca de Economii, Unibank and Banca Socială), as well as representatives of the Shor holding. Since then, the defendant has been under house arrest. At the same time, the former BEM special administrator, the current head of the National Bank's department, Ion Ropot, was detained on March 11 and then placed under arrest. The Prosecutor's Office for Combating Organized Crime and Special Cases is currently investigating his activities for “abuse of office” in the management of bank guarantees provided by the NBM to Banca de Economii, Unibank and Banca Socială. The Prosecutor General's Office noted that the criminal investigation is ongoing, and the Prosecutor's Office will provide additional information on the measures taken and the results obtained, and also recalled that any person is considered innocent until a final court decision is approved. // 24.03.2021 - InfoMarket.
